which project management solutions do you know, which fullfill the following contraints:

  • Report customer issue
  • Create development tasks assiciated with the issue
  • Associate development and q/a documents to the tasks
  • Create a patch/revision which contains the development result
  • Associate patch/revision with customer issue

Another problem we face is that each customer has a slightly different code base. And not all customers want to have all features/fixes.

Are there Open Source / Commercial project management solutions, which would fit those requirements?

    There is a Open Source Ticketsystem called Trac, in connection with SVN you can connect Tickets with revisions, create a own ticketsystem for each customer, and so on (:

    Its running on a Apache Server, and its looking like the Homepage

    Link: http://trac.edgewall.org/
